How they compare

Liberia currently reports 1,097 deaths per 1,000 people against 1,081 deaths per 1,000 people in San Marino, a difference of 16 deaths per 1,000 people.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 61 shared years of data; in 2030 it was San Marino ahead.

Liberia ranks 155th and San Marino ranks 158th of 236 countries.

Across the 7 decades both report, Liberia averaged higher in 1 and San Marino in 6.
